Changed defaults in Splitfork, our assignment service. Bucketing now uses sticky hashing per account instead of per session, and the holdout slice grew from 2% to 5%. Callers relying on session-level reassignment must opt in explicitly. Review the diff against the new baseline; the updated default configuration is listed below.

config for tagep-kajof:
[casir]
port = 6379
region = south-1
host = casir.paliqdyn.example
team = tamax
timeout_ms = 250
retries = 2

Handover for Bramble, our email bounce processor. Hard bounces drain normally; the soft-bounce retry queue has a slow leak I've been watching — check depth each morning. If the processor's credential store locks (it did twice this week after failed rotations), you'll need to reinitialize it via the Corvid admin shell, which asks for the recovery passphrase. I'm leaving it here for you.

vault phrase of tajop-haduf = holath-brivan-wenax

The Tidewrack sweeper reclaims volumes, load-balancer stubs, and snapshot chains left behind by failed Harborline provisioning jobs. It runs nightly, but during incident cleanup you may trigger it manually. Always run with `--dry-run` first and review the candidate list in the Driftlog viewer; anything tagged `keep-forever` must be skipped, no exceptions. Manual sweeps require a two-person acknowledgment recorded in the shift notes. To invoke the sweeper's admin endpoint, authenticate with the internal key that follows.

app token of tagef-tafog = qvz3-7n0

## Sensor drift: what to do at 3am

If the GrowLoop controller starts reporting humidity swings that don't match the backup probes in the Fernwick greenhouse, it's almost always sensor drift, not an actual climate event. Don't panic and don't touch the vents manually. First, restart the calibration daemon and give it ten minutes to re-baseline. If readings still disagree by more than 5%, flip the controller into safe mode. The safe-mode thresholds it will use are these.

config for yahap-bajof:
[istix]
host = istix.qorvelsys.internal
user = istix_svc
database = istix_prod